Error description
When using iSCSI with an IBM V7000 (and possibly other devices), if SendTargets discovery is used to configure the targets, the iSCSI login fails, causing no devices to be found. This failure will be accompanied by an ISCSISW_ERR1 error report entry in the system error report with this first 12 bytes of sense data: 0000 0000 0000 40E3 0000 000B

Problem conclusion
Modified the iSCSI driver to ensure that targets do not try to negotiate for header or data digests on discovery session logins.
